Steps to Apply for Admission
- Send completed Application and application fee ($25 for day and boarding students, $150 for
students residing outside of the United States).
- Complete the Parent Questionnaire and Student Questionnaire and send to Reserve prior to your visit as this helps
us to customize your day.
- Complete an on-campus interview and shadow day.
- Give Transcript Release Form to current school.
- Give the Common English Recommendation Form and Common Math Recommendation Form to your current English and Math teachers, respectively.
- Give the Common School Report Form to the designated school official.
- Give the Other Recommendation Form to a coach, former or current teacher, scout leader, voice
teacher, etc.
- Sign up for a standardized test. Grades 9 and 10: SSAT or ISEE; Grades 11, 12 and PG: PSAT,
ACT or SAT; International Students: SSAT or ISEE and TOEFL or IELTS.

Deadlines
Day student applications should be received by the Admission Office by Dec. 15, with notification to be sent on Jan. 10.
Boarding student applications should be received by the Admission Office by Jan. 15, with notification to be sent on March
10. After Jan. 15, applications are welcome and will be considered as long as spaces are available. Please call the Admission
